Transaction 8a156573c42031868124f1a4d95e53af7d5bdf2085ee6f08b8d7f33028424056
1 Input
1 Output
-
8a156573c42031868124f1a4d95e53af7d5bdf2085ee6f08b8d7f33028424056:0
- value
- 1649212
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ba70af50bd879655475b78192517a99aab4e443b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HzogAFG2byKg83FGEwCzJrg1hXmtH8oFC